Police searching for missing 76-year-old York man Anthony Atkinson have recovered a body from the River Ouse at Clifton Ings.
A member of the public made a report to North Yorkshire Fire and Rescue service at around 2.40pm today (Thursday) after noticing a figure in the water between Clifton Bridge and the A1237.
The fire boat crew helped to secure the body while the police Under Water Search Unit arrived from Humberside to make the recovery. This was completed at 5pm.
The York Rescue Boat also assisted the operation.
Although the body has not yet been formally identified, it is believed to be Mr Atkinson. His family have been informed and are being supported by the police.
Police enquiries are continuing to investigate the missing person case.
